Marine Corps Cpl. Charlotte Marchek, a mobile facility technician with Marine Aviation Logistics Squadron 12, left, shakes hands with Maj. Gen. Brian Cavanaugh, commanding general of 1st Marine Aircraft Wing, at Marine Corps Air Station Iwakuni, Japan, March 8, 2022. Marchek was awarded the Navy and Marine Corps Achievement Medal for being the 1st Marine Aircraft Wing Marine of the year. Marine of the year is awarded to Marines who demonstrate leadership and bravery in the course of their service, offer outstanding support with whom they serve, enhance morale, and, through their mentorship, inspire others.
